LM Studio is a local runtime for large language models that recently introduced Bionic, an agent tailored for work and coding tasks. Users can download and run local models directly for simple chats or advanced agentic tasks. Bionic assists with creating and editing documents, coding, automations, and computer control. Features include real-time local voice transcription, support for frontier open models like GLM 5.2 and DeepSeek V4 Pro, and Zero Data Retention for cloud services. Privacy is central to the LM Studio ethos.
